This single, compact volume describes and beautifully illustrates over 500 species of plants and animals found in the Cascade Range from northern California to British Columbia and in the Olympic Mountains of Washington. It also covers B.C.'s Coast Mountains and the Vancouver Island Range. Wildflowers, trees, shrubs, ferns, butterflies, trout and salmon, amphibians, reptiles, birds, mammals: they are all here in beautiful full-page paintings and drawings- 36 pages in full color, 54 in black and white.

Some places in this world are still wild, remote and untouched. The outer coast of Vancouver island is one such remarkable place. Author and explorer John Kimantas takes you through this phenomenal stretch of coastline, both by foot and by water, in unparalleled detail. It includes the type of detail that made his first series of guide books, the Wild Coast series, the quintessential resource for information on the most remote locations on the BC coast. This is the heir to that series, updated to include changes such as the Maa-nulth Treaty, the initiatives of the BC Marine Trails Network and other political, environmental and social changes that are continuing to shape these lands. Through maps, photography and description, The BC Coast Explorer series provides the building blocks for the adventure of a lifetime. By foot or paddle, this volume will take you to places rarely seen and yet too beautiful to miss. Covered in detail, feature by feature, are north Vancouver Island and Cape Scott, Brooks Peninsula and all five West Coast Sounds: Quatsino, Kyuquot, Nootka, Clayoquot and Barkley sounds. Included are launches, points of interest, campsites and all the necessary details to get you there. The toughest part will be deciding where to go.
